引言
随着人工智能技术的飞速发展,大型语言模型(LLM)如GPT-3、LaMDA等已经在各个领域展现出惊人的能力。然而,这些模型通常需要强大的服务器和云端资源,对于许多个人用户和中小企业来说,使用这些模型存在一定的门槛。Dbrx大模型的出现,为我们提供了一种新的可能性——本地部署。本文将深入探讨Dbrx大模型的特性、部署方法以及其在不同领域的应用。
Dbrx大模型概述
1.1 模型结构
Dbrx大模型基于深度学习技术,采用了类似于GPT-3的Transformer架构。它由多个编码器和解码器堆叠而成,能够处理和理解复杂的语言任务。
1.2 模型特点
- 高性能:Dbrx模型在多个语言处理任务上取得了与GPT-3相媲美的性能。
- 可扩展性:支持从小型模型到大型模型的灵活扩展。
- 本地部署:无需依赖云端资源,用户可以在本地设备上运行。
Dbrx大模型的本地部署
2.1 硬件要求
- CPU/GPU:推荐使用NVIDIA GPU,如Tesla V100或更高版本。
- 内存:至少16GB RAM。
- 存储:至少1TB SSD存储空间。
2.2 软件要求
- 操作系统:支持Windows、Linux和macOS。
- 深度学习框架:PyTorch或TensorFlow。
- 编译器:CMake。
2.3 部署步骤
- 下载模型:从Dbrx官方网站下载预训练模型。
- 安装依赖:按照官方文档安装必要的软件和库。
- 编译模型:使用CMake编译模型。
- 运行模型:在本地设备上运行Dbrx模型。
Dbrx大模型的应用
3.1 自然语言处理
- 机器翻译:Dbrx模型可以用于机器翻译任务,支持多种语言之间的翻译。
- 文本摘要:自动生成长文本的摘要,节省阅读时间。
3.2 计算机视觉
- 图像识别:Dbrx模型可以用于图像识别任务,如物体检测、场景识别等。
3.3 语音识别
- 语音到文本:将语音转换为文本,方便后续处理。
结论
Dbrx大模型的出现为本地部署大型语言模型提供了新的可能。通过本地部署,用户可以在不依赖云端资源的情况下,享受到大型语言模型带来的便利。随着技术的不断发展,Dbrx模型将在更多领域发挥重要作用。